Unsplash是一个免费的高清图片资源网站,它提供了一个API,方便用户在自己的网站中使用Unsplash的图片资源。我们可以在Unsplash API官网中注册账号,获取API的链接。
在使用Unsplash API链接前,需要了解几个基本概念:
client_id
: 一个用于限制API请求的唯一标识符。query
: 用于指定图片资源的搜索关键词。w
, h
:用于设置图片的宽度和高度,可以以像素为单位进行指定。例如,我们可以通过以下URL获取一张600x337像素的汽车图片:
https://source.unsplash.com/600x337/?car
要在网站中使用Unsplash API获取的图片,我们可以通过img标签插入图片,示例如下:
<img src="https://source.unsplash.com/600x337/?car" alt="汽车图片">
其中,src
属性指定图片的URL,alt
属性指定图片的文本描述,以方便屏幕阅读器等无障碍设备使用。
为了提高网站的加载速度和用户体验,我们需要对网站中的图片进行优化。下面是一些优化图片的技巧:
如果你使用的是合适的图片格式,那么你可以轻松地将图片压缩到较小的文件大小。有许多工具可以帮助你实现这一点,如Adobe Photoshop、TinyPNG、Kraken等。
根据你的需求和图片本身的内容,你可以选择不同的图片格式。JPEG格式适用于照片和其他具有颜色渐变和细节的图像,PNG格式适用于具有少量颜色和图块较多的图像(如图标、图表、简单的图形),而GIF格式适用于动画图像。
为了避免图片在加载时产生的页面跳动,你可以在img标签中设置固定的宽高,以便在加载前为图片预留出空间。
对于移动设备等不同分辨率的设备,我们可以使用响应式图片来适应不同的屏幕大小,这可以提高网站的性能和用户体验。
通过对网站中的图片进行压缩、选择正确的图片格式、设置图片的宽高以及使用响应式图片,我们可以有效地优化网站的图片,提高网站的性能和用户体验。
在实现SEO优化时,我们需要综合考虑网站的各个方面,从网站的内容、结构、质量到媒体资源的优化等方面进行完善和优化,以提高网站的搜索排名和用户流量。同时,我们也需要及时跟进搜索引擎的更新和规则,以不断优化和完善网站的SEO策略。希望这篇文章能对你有所帮助。